How We Started
Back in January of 2025 an SMP we played on was unexpectedly shut down. It was very upsetting as we really enjoyed playing with each other and it was a lotta fun.
Then Felix said, "We should just make our own server". At first it was just a joke: "Us? Running a server? Yeah right" But after contemplating for a while we thought "What's stopping us?" So we started the Temporary Server Name SMP, which would later be shortened to TSN.
We spent countless days and nights preparing a modpack and picking out the best datapacks to create seamless bedrock player compatibility with Java as it was a part of what we wanted. And in the end we managed to create an amazing experience for everyone involved.
Server launch
Season 1 was crazy. We invited a few of our friends, they invited their friends to play, and suddenly we had this massive playerbase! It was incredible to see how many people wanted to play on our server and the energy was amazing, but after a while it got a bit overwhelming. We felt like we didn't know anyone on our own server anymore and everyone was doing their own thing.
With season 1 getting stale and us wanting to move on, both as a minecraft world and as people we wanted to start fresh and pick members a bit better after season 1 had a bit of mishaps with griefing.
Getting Our Groove Back
Around July 2025 we decided to start over, we were very happy with how season 1 went overall but we wanted to get that tight-knit vibe back. So as we launched season 2 we decided to add an application feature where the members of the server can first look at who the people are that want to join and decide together if we think they would add to the good vibes of the group. ❤️
Season 2 also brought a natural shift in who was steering the ship. Felix and BlueRat became less available and less invested as life pulled them in other directions, and that's totally okay! The server found new owners who were just as passionate, and the community kept thriving without missing a beat.
